After merges of the upstream WebRTC.org library into the Firefox codebase, it is not unusual for RTCP stats to break. One of the common failure modalities is using local RTCP stats for the remote stats. I propose adding a pref that quashes RTCP traffic which can be used in tests to to ensure that RTCP stats are not received when disabled.
